CLAMP is a highly skilled female mangaka group that is well-known for popular series such as Cardcaptor SakuraCode Geass (which exists as a collboration) and Clover, among many others. With plots full of twists that will keep fans guessing, deep characters who do not always do the right thing, and magical girls so kind and well-intentioned readers cannot help but cheer for them, it's no wonder CLAMP series' are so well-loved.

If there is one thing that rivals CLAMP's writing prowess, it is their fantastic art. While CLAMP art is consistently polished and pleasing to look at, the group goes above and beyond when doing illustrations for one of their many series. These illustrations are full-color, perfectly lined, and extremely detailed. With artwork across multiple series, CLAMP ensures there is a beautiful illustration waiting for every fan.

10  Sakura And Akiho Celebrate Winter

Cardcaptor Sakura Clear Card Arc Sakura And Akiho Illustration By Clamp

This CLAMP illustration from the Cardcaptor Sakura Exhibition artbook depicts Sakura and her new friend, Akiho, from the sequel series Cardcaptor Sakura: Clear Card Arc, wearing winter-themed outfits as snowflakes fall in the background. The soft colors and gentle feel of this illustration are pleasing to the eye, while the amazing detail and delicate application add to its beauty.

The dresses, in particular, have an exquisite amount of detail with layer after layer of ruffles sitting very naturally and looking quite delicate. CLAMP shows just how far they've come with this beautiful piece of art.

9 Chii Relaxes In A Tree

Chii Relaxes In A Tree In Chobits Illustration By Clamp

From the ever-popular seriesChobits comes this beautiful and sweet illustration of Chii, featured in the Your Eyes Only artbook by CLAMP. The autumn colors contrast beautifully with Chii's neutral color palette as she lounges on a tree branch. Chii's exquisitely detailed dress, delicate pose, and fluttering ribbon add to the gentle aesthetic of the illustration.

Small details such as the grooves in the bark and the way the leaves cross over the smaller tree branches give the image a sense of realism. Special care has been paid to everything, right down to the way her hair hugs her face as she smiles out at the viewer. This illustration is a work of art.

8 Suu Blends In With The Birds

Suu Relaxes With Wings and Birds In Clover Illustration By Clamp

From the CLAMP artbook CLAMP: North Side comes this beautiful illustration of Suu as she leans on a broken statue. While the statue still shines, CLAMP has taken special care to show it weathering in various spots, a small detail that ages the statue nicely.

Suu relaxes on top in a contrasting black and white outfit with beautiful gold detailing to match the statue. The wires wrapping around her wings and spanning across the illustration contrast the mechanical birds, giving the image the feel of being both caged and free at the same time.

7 Fai Relaxes With Ashura

Fai And Ashura Relaxing In Ice Palace In Tsubasa Reservoir Chronicle Illustration By Clamp

This stunning illustration of Fai and Ashura from the manga version of CLAMP's Tsubasa Reservoir Chronicle is found in the Tsubasa Illustration Chronicle artbook. Set in a winter background, CLAMP displays their amazing skills with light and shadow, leaving no doubt as to what the ice in the background is. Fai and Ashura blend into the scene with their neutral colors, with Fai's cloak offering a nice contrast.

The detail from the cloak design to the subtle shading on the fur trim to the blended grays of the background sets the atmosphere so well, the viewer may feel chilled just looking at it.

6 Once Friends, Now Foes

Lelouch And Suzaku Clash In Code Geass Illustration By Clamp

Lelouch and Suzaku of Code Geass clash in this jaw-dropping illustration from CLAMP's Code Geass: Mutuality artbook. The amount of symbolism in this one image is stunning. The color palettes for each set of clothes sit opposite each other on the color wheel, creating a balance in the image. Suzaku is portrayed wearing white, while Lelouch sports darker clothing.

The choice is interesting, as, on the surface, Suzaku does appear to be the more classically good character, while Lelouch appears morally gray. However, there is always more than meets the eye with CLAMPThe gold detailing in the background and the way it opens into the sky resembles an eye, perhaps a nod to Lelouch's ability.

5 Kaho Dons Her Priestess Attire

Kaho Wearing Priestess Attire In Cardcaptor Sakura Illustration By Clamp

This gorgeous illustration from CLAMP's Cardcaptor Sakura Artbook 1 features Kaho in a priestess outfit, complete with Clow Reed's bell in hand. Kaho draws her power from the moon, so it feels very appropriate for the background to feature a night sky that highlights the full moon.

With her hair blowing all around her and the wind pulling the ribbons on her bell, Kaho glows in this picture, looking somewhat ethereal. Her gentle expression matches perfectly with her robes. This CLAMP illustration is certainly more simple than some of the others but is strikingly beautiful nonetheless.

4 Watanuki Has A Moment To Relax

Watanuki Relaxing In XXXHolic Illustration By Clamp

This fantastic CLAMP illustration of Watanuki from the manga version of xxxHolic comes from the Memories: The Art of CLAMP book. This image uses many of the colors of fall in its palette, featuring Watanuki relaxing on a yellow blanket as the autumn leaves drop around him. Watanuki's outfit includes many subtle nods to the season, featuring leaf-shaped pankou on the sleeves and front of the shirt, and an organic pattern used across the entire outfit.

With his glasses removed, a fan in his hand, and a gentle setting, viewers may find themselves relaxing as they soak in the atmosphere of this lovely illustration.

3 Suu and Kazuhiko Take A Break In A Garden

Suu And Kazuhiko Relax In A Garden Setting In Clover Illustration By Clamp

This stunning illustration of Suu and Kazuhiko from Clover is featured in the CLAMP: North Side artbook. The background of this image is one of the more elaborate CLAMP artworks, featuring a highly-detailed building with symmetrical window panes, and a lush garden of trees and shrubbery. As Kazuhiko rests on Suu's lap, the birds fly around them. Suu's elaborate white outfit and wings are contrasted by Kazuhiko's simple black suit.

The entire piece feels nicely balanced and tranquil, from the backdrop to the characters to the birds and gear in the foreground. The intricate details poured into this illustration truly makes this piece stand out.

2 Chii Shines Among The Flowers

Chii Smiling With Flowers in Chobits Illustration By Clamp

From the CLAMP art book, Your Eyes Only comes a beautiful illustration of Chii from Chobits. Chii is clad in a veil and holding a bouquet in this artwork that feels reminiscent of Spring. The gentle veil blowing in the breeze coupled with the soft ruffles in her dress and the light pink trim contribute to a very feminine and gentle feel from this illustration. The flowers, in particular, are extremely detailed, with everything from leaves and stems to buds and full blooms included in this realistic bouquet.

Chii's happy expression completes the image, and its infectious nature will have fans smiling as they gaze upon it.

1 Nunnally Feels The Effects Of War

Code Geass Illustration Of Nunnally In A Dress With Rubble By Clamp

This Code Geass illustration of Nunnally comes from the Code Geass: Mutuality artbook. Nunnally's fancy dress and gentle nature are juxtaposed by the rubble around her and the bright red cloak embellished with the crest of the Brittanian Armed Forces. The crumbled structures have given Nunnally the appearance of having wings, which adds to her overall ethereal look amidst the rubble.

In her hand, Nunnally holds a cage. However, the birds inside are free and flying away. The entire illustration feels very symbolic, and ties in with the themes of the Code Geass series and with Nunnally nicely. This stunning piece is one of CLAMP's best creations.
